Potholing explained: the safer way to verify underground services
Potholing is the process of carefully exposing underground services so you can verify exactly what’s there — before digging, drilling, or trenching.

Why potholing is used
- To reduce the risk of striking power, gas, comms, or water lines
- To confirm depth and alignment when plans are uncertain
- To make civil work safer and more predictable
Vacuum excavation advantage
Vacuum methods can be lower-risk around buried services and keep the work area cleaner.
